The term that refers to when a contractor provides services in exchange for monetary compensation is "consideration." In the context of contracts and agreements, consideration is the value that is exchanged between parties. It can be a payment, a service, or something of value that one party provides to another as part of an agreement.
In the case of contractors, when they render services, the agreement typically stipulates that they will receive monetary compensation in return. This reciprocal agreement is fundamental to contractual obligations, as it solidifies the commitment both parties have towards fulfilling their roles. Consideration is necessary for a contract to be legally enforceable, distinguishing it from gifts or unilateral offers, where no exchange occurs.
Other terms such as compensation, honorarium, and salary, while related to payment, do not capture the specific legal context of an exchange in a contractual relationship as accurately as "consideration" does. Compensation generally refers to payment for services rendered and can encompass various forms of payment, but it lacks the formal contractual implications that consideration embodies. An honorarium is typically a voluntary payment to someone for their services, usually in a professional context where a fee is not the norm.
